Feet don’t fail us now — Mardi Gras is in full swing at Universal Orlando!

The celebration kicks off several weeks of great food booths, exclusive merch, a full concert lineup featuring popular artists, and even an interactive parade (complete with beads to catch) happening nightly throughout the event. But one of our favorite things to come within the most recent years is the seasonal-themed tribute store. Let’s take a look at what’s inside!
This year’s tribute store is located where the old Prop Store was in the Hollywood section of the park. This is where some of the tribute stores are held (when they’re not located near Revenge of the Mummy in the New York section of the park).
The entrance resembles a shipyard, offering River Cruises and donning a port entrance alongside various other shipping crates and things. 
As you walk inside, the store is made of several themed rooms. The first room you come to is the fictional Mississippi River Steamboat, P.S. Songbird that met its demise. The P.S. Songbird room is the first introduction to the Tribute Store storyline and Mardi Gras 2024 merchandise!

With velvet curtains and props resembling luggage, it’s easy to see the luxury that passengers of the P.S. Songbird experienced while onboard. The P.S. Songbird room features merchandise nestled in pristine white displays lined with the same velvet curtains seen in the beginning of the store’s first room.

The second room finds guests thrust into the ballroom of the P.S. Songbird, now decrepit and run down, representing the downfall of the ship.

As you make your way through the store you will get to see remnants of what was once a bustling ballroom.

Just as you think you’re making your way deeper into the ship, you’re instead transported into the center of the action in the Bayou!

Projections on the floor dance around and simulate rain, water, and even King Croc, so be careful where you step!

The artfully crafted shipwrecks are scattered throughout this room, housing merchandise and even a small snack stand inside filled with treats and candies to enjoy!

The final room of the Tribute Store represents the crossover from the spirit realm to the mortal realm, mixing skeletons and illuminated spirits to further push this narrative.
